NYF’s 2024 Radio Awards Grand Jury Revealed

All Entries in NYF’s 2024 Radio Awards will be judged by the NYF Grand Jury of 100+ producers, directors, writers, and other creative media professionals from around the globe. Entries are judged on production values, creativity, content presentation, direction, writing, achievement of purpose, and audience suitability.

Red Sox Radio Voice Chosen For Frick Award

The Ford C. Frick Award is presented annually for excellence in broadcasting by the National Baseball Hall of Fame and Museum. Next year, it will be awarded to the radio voice of the Boston Red Sox.

National Broadcast Of ‘Celebration of Service to America’ Awards All Set

A one-hour television and radio special of the 2023 Celebration of Service to America Awards will air nationally on over 700 local television and radio broadcast stations across the country beginning November 27, through December 24.
